A company determined that the marginal​ cost, C' (x )of producing the xth unit of a product is given by C' (x )= x^3- 6x. Find t

he total cost function​ C, assuming that​ C(x) is in dollars and that fixed costs are ​$3000.

Answer:

C(x) = \frac{x^4}{4}-3x^2+3,000

Step-by-step explanation:

The marginal cost function, C'(x), is the derivate of the cost function, C(x).

Therefore, we can obtain the cost function by finding the integral of the marginal cost function:

C(x) = \int\ {C'(x)} \, dx \\C(x) = \int\ {(x^3-6x)} \, dx \\C(x) = \frac{1}{4} x^4-3x^2+a

Where 'a' is a constant and represents fixed costs. If fixed costs are $3,000, the cost function is:

C(x) = \frac{x^4}{4}-3x^2+3,000
